Posted by Happy News
NASCAR driver Alex Bowman advocates animal rescue. In one of the NASCAR events, he sported a car painted with “Best Friends Animal Society.” This move caught the attention of Ally Nascar, committing thousands of donations to animal rescue centers.
This post was created with our nice and easy submission form. Create your post!